Output 750b8f5fb18fce8bf4647bb0528867837cdf291f17c449e125054e53339e59c9:47

value
150461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8204b52828c67e6dbb7cdbdb79a3bf6cfacae0 OP_EQUAL
address
3EKNvrPkyytCqtioCuTRzMmrUU9pcwpRe6
transaction
750b8f5fb18fce8bf4647bb0528867837cdf291f17c449e125054e53339e59c9
confirmations
193905
spent
true